What the ENTJ personality type is often like
ENTJs often organize the room around the next useful move. They notice inefficiency, weak decisions, and unclear ownership faster than most people expect.
Their confidence can look effortless, but much of it comes from actively reducing ambiguity.
How ENTJs tend to connect
They often connect through respect, ambition, and shared momentum. They may show care by pushing someone toward a stronger version of themselves.
When relaxed, they can be warm, generous, and surprisingly loyal to people who have earned their trust.
Why ENTJs can feel misunderstood
They may feel misunderstood when directness is treated as aggression, or when their need for progress is read as a lack of feeling.
They can struggle when others want emotional validation before practical movement.

Common questions
What does ENTJ mean?
ENTJ is often read as Extraverted, Intuitive, Thinking, and Judging. In plain language, it points to outward direction, strategy, standards, and decisive movement.
What is the ENTJ personality type like in conversation?
ENTJs often communicate by naming the goal, the constraint, and the next useful move. Emotional trust may grow when the conversation stays honest and competent.
Why do ENTJs feel misunderstood?
ENTJs may feel misunderstood when directness is treated as aggression, or when practical movement is read as a lack of care.

ENTJ vs ESTJ: what is the difference?
ENTJs often focus on strategy, leverage, and future systems. ESTJs often focus on execution, standards, precedent, and making current responsibilities work.
Are ENTJs only focused on success?
No. Many care about impact, loyalty, and competence; achievement is often one visible expression of that.
